This is what I am talking about when one is stuck on an infinite loop, wherein you are trapped into the illusion of recovering your losses through gambling. Meaning, the cycle of gambling is never ending. When someone wins in gambling, they tend to gamble more and if they lost they gamble AGAIN hoping that they could recover their losses in a similar manner. Your attitude towards losing lacks self-discipline and control as you do not know WHEN and HOW to stop.

I do not blame you though, as it may be really difficult to exalt yourself from this addiction but you need to fathom that gambling will only make your situation a lot worse from before. Consider your losses as something that cannot be regained and move-on to a next chapter in your book.

Addiction isn't easy to quit, and I've personally experienced this in the past. What really helped me stop thoughtlessly gambling was the realization that there were much better options for making money outside of gambling out there. Loaning to exchanges and users (with collateral), and even investing in the bankrolls of casinos are essentially foolproof (but don't put all your eggs in one basket), and though they only give out small percentages in profit monthly, the real bright side of these investments is that there's very little risk to them.

I still gamble today, and that's one of the things people should realise about gambling today, too- quitting an addiction doesn't mean you have to completely stop doing something. I still set aside a few dollars for gambling weekly. Sometimes I win, sometimes not, but the important thing is to not throw all your money into the hole that is gambling. I primarily gamble for the thrill and not for a profit, though it does feel good when I get a sizable win.
